Gap funding
| Grantee | FY26 allocations | Live posture |
|---|---|---|
| State Of Indiana (state) | CDBG $30.9M · HOME $13.3M | HOME undrawn $49.5M |
Allocations are FY2026 HUD formula amounts (annual scale, not balances). "Undrawn" = obligated-not-yet-drawn on FY2020+ formula grants (USASpending, monthly), which may be committed to projects. Timeliness is a proxy for HUD's 24 CFR 570.902 standard (1.5× line); program income is not visible in public data.
